| namespace SceneUtil
 | |
| {
 | |
|     /// @brief Implements per-view RTT operations.
 | |
|     /// @par With a naive RTT implementation, subsequent views of multiple views will overwrite the results of the
 | |
|     /// previous views, leading to
 | |
|     ///     the results of the last view being broadcast to all views. An error in all cases where the RTT result
 | |
|     ///     depends on the view.
 | |
|     /// @par If using an RTTNode this is solved by mapping RTT operations to CullVisitors, which will be unique per
 | |
|     /// view. This requires
 | |
|     ///     instancing one camera per view, and traversing only the camera mapped to that CV during cull traversals.
 | |
|     /// @par Camera settings should be effectuated by overriding the setDefaults() and apply() methods, following a
 | |
|     /// pattern similar to SceneUtil::StateSetUpdater
 | |
|     /// @par When using the RTT texture in your statesets, it is recommended to use SceneUtil::StateSetUpdater as a cull
 | |
|     /// callback to handle this as the appropriate
 | |
|     ///     textures can be retrieved during SceneUtil::StateSetUpdater::Apply()
 | |
|     /// @par For any of COLOR_BUFFER or PACKED_DEPTH_STENCIL_BUFFER not added during setDefaults(), RTTNode will attach
 | |
|     /// a default buffer. The default color buffer has an internal format of GL_RGB.
 | |
|     ///     The default depth buffer has internal format GL_DEPTH_COMPONENT24, source format GL_DEPTH_COMPONENT, and
 | |
|     ///     source type GL_UNSIGNED_INT. Default wrap is CLAMP_TO_EDGE and filter LINEAR.
 | |
|     class RTTNode : public osg::Node
 | |
|     {
 | |
|     public:
 | |
|         enum class StereoAwareness
 | |
|         {
 | |
|             Unaware, //! RTT does not vary by view. A single RTT context is created
 | |
|             Aware, //! RTT varies by view. One RTT context per view is created. Textures are automatically created as
 | |
|                    //! arrays if multiview is enabled.
 | |
|             Unaware_MultiViewShaders, //! RTT does not vary by view, but renders with multiview shaders and needs to
 | |
|                                       //! create texture arrays if multiview is enabled.
 | |
|         };
 | |
| 
 | |
|         RTTNode(uint32_t textureWidth, uint32_t textureHeight, uint32_t samples, bool generateMipmaps,
 | |
|             int renderOrderNum, StereoAwareness stereoAwareness, bool addMSAAIntermediateTarget);
